Step 1: Assessment & Digital Quote
We inspect, document, and photograph all damage. You receive a clear, itemized digital estimate.
Step 2: Wood Stabilization & Rot Removal
We safely remove rotted fibers and stabilize anything salvageable using a marine-grade wood consolidator.
Step 3: Structural Epoxy Application
We rebuild missing or weakened sections using a chemical-bonding epoxy system that becomes stronger than the original lumber.
Step 4: Sculpting, Sanding & Finishing
We shape the repair to match original contours — perfect for windows, sills, casings, and decorative trim.
Step 5: Priming, Sealing & Protection
We finish the area with high-quality primer or stain to lock out future moisture.
Step 6: Final Walkthrough & Warranty
We review the project with you, share before/after photos, and activate your 10-year warranty.

Pricing: What Affects the Cost of Wood Rot Repair?
- Severity of the rot
- Size & location of the damaged component
- Accessibility (e.g., second-floor windows)
- Required finishing or repainting
- Pre-existing poor repairs that must be removed

How do I know if I have wood rot?
- Soft or spongy wood
- Flaking or bubbling paint
- Cracks, gaps, or discoloration
- Musty or damp smells
- Crumbly or hollow areas near windows or doors
